Queen's breakout self titled debut UK album boldly signed by the entire band. This EMI - EMC 3006 album is a first British pressing, it has the "...and nobody played synthesizer" on the rear panel (cover). The record is included and the matrix numbers and info in the run outs are as follows: Side One YAX 4623 - 3U KIP HUGGYPOO KISSY   Side Two YAX 4624 - 3U AGAIN!

The signature placements are perfect, with all the band signing in the rays of the spotlight with Freddie beautifully signing right next to his image!!

This incredibly rare signed Queen album comes with impeccable provenance, it was obtained during their first headline tour in March of 1974 by Keith Mullholland the bass guitarist for the the band Nutz who were the supporting band on the tour.
